Abstract
This paper designs a power system for an electric car. Particular emphasis is placed on the choice of motors and batteries to create a complete powertrain. For example, in the first chapter, we analyze the advantages and disadvantages of the internal structure, working principle and use of the motor as the entry point, and finally determine the type of motor to be selected. In the second chapter, we combine the final design goals, carry out specific mathematical calculations, and determine the specific parameters of the required motor power, torque and so on. Furthermore, several different brands but the same type of motor were analyzed.
After confirming the transmission and the inverter, the whole system was simulated
